Birgitte Schoenmakers is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Psychiatry and Mental health. According to data from OpenAlex, Birgitte Schoenmakers has authored 89 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 30 papers in General Health Professions, 28 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and 28 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health. Recurrent topics in Birgitte Schoenmakers's work include Dementia and Cognitive Impairment Research (20 papers), Innovations in Medical Education (15 papers) and Chronic Disease Management Strategies (11 papers). Birgitte Schoenmakers is often cited by papers focused on Dementia and Cognitive Impairment Research (20 papers), Innovations in Medical Education (15 papers) and Chronic Disease Management Strategies (11 papers). Birgitte Schoenmakers collaborates with scholars based in Belgium, United States and Netherlands. Birgitte Schoenmakers's co-authors include Frank Buntinx, Jan Delepeleire, Jan De Lepeleire, Jos Tournoy, Marc M. Van Hulle, Louis Paquay, Benjamin Wittevrongel, Ovide Fontaine, Martine Goossens and Johan Wens and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, SLEEP and Frontiers in Psychology.
